A leading fluid technology company is seeking an Area Sales Manager to work remotely from the West Midlands. You will be responsible for managing accounts, exceeding sales targets, and developing customer relationships in the HVAC sector.
The ideal candidate will have an engineering degree and significant sales experience. This position offers full-time opportunities with a focus on innovation and collaboration.
